wooden-block-spell-out-smile-laying-on-cTraditional methods such as manual rodding and high-pressure water jetting are still ubiquitous due to their capability to deal effectively with blockages. However, in recent years, an appreciable shift towards more technologically integrated methods has been observed. Drain camera surveys are emerging as a go-to-choice among professionals. This method allows for a comprehensive analysis of the whole drainage system, identifying the exact location of blockages and their severity, leading to a targeted and effective resolution.

During the observational research, it was noted that such advanced methods vastly reduced the time taken to identify the problem, allowing for a quicker response. Moreover, it was observed that professionals are favoring biodegradable, non-toxic, and non-caustic cleaning materials over chemical-based solutions for unblocking the drains. This highlights an increasing awareness about the environmental and health hazards associated with traditional drain cleaning agents.

However, it was observed, despite these innovations, difficulties remained. One of the most noticeable issues was dealing with recurring blockages. In many cases, the drains cleared successfully would block up again due to the systemic issues. For example, a pipe with an inadequate gradient can result in slow drainage and recurrent blockages, necessitating back and forth visits from the professionals.

Another significant observation was the geographical split in the employed techniques. While urban areas saw more usage of high-tech tools for unblocking solutions, rural areas still heavily relied on traditional techniques owing to the lack of access to newer tools and methods. This received widespread attention for the evident need to level the field for the rural populace.

The attitude of customers was another fascinating insight. Many customers treated drain unblocking aylesbury unblocking as an emergency service. This reactive approach often leads to more critical issues that require expensive repairs. A preventive, proactive approach to drain maintenance is undeniably more cost-effective in the long run and could greatly reduce the number of emergency blockages.

The necessity for well-trained professionals within the sector was underlined in the observation. The new tools and methods require specific training and understanding, which in effect determines the success of the operation. Therefore, drain unblocking services need to invest in continuous training for their technical staff.
